The main reason standard systems fail is simple: they cannot handle the physical changes that happen at low temperatures.<\/p>\n<h3>How Cold Affects Standard Hydraulic Systems<\/h3>\n<ul>\n<li><strong>Oil Viscosity Changes:<\/strong> Hydraulic oil is like blood in the machine&#8217;s veins. In normal temperatures, it flows smoothly. But when it gets very cold, it becomes thick, like honey. This thick oil does not flow easily through the pumps, valves, and cylinders. It makes the machine move slowly, or not at all. This also puts a lot of stress on the pump, causing it to wear out faster. It is like trying to pump thick mud instead of water. The pump has to work much harder. This extra work uses more energy and can lead to early failure of important parts.<\/li>\n<li><strong>Material Brittleness:<\/strong> Many standard metal parts and seals become brittle in extreme cold. This means they can crack or break easily under stress. A hydraulic hose that is flexible at room temperature might become stiff and prone to cracking when frozen. Seals can lose their ability to prevent leaks. Imagine a rubber band that snaps when you stretch it in the cold. This is similar to what happens to these critical components. When parts break, the machine stops completely. This leads to costly repairs and long periods of downtime.<\/li>\n<li><strong>Condensation and Freezing:<\/strong> When warm air mixes with cold air, water can form. This condensation can collect inside hydraulic lines and tanks. If the temperature drops even further, this water can freeze. Frozen water expands, and this expansion can damage pipes, valves, and even the pump. It creates blockages that stop the hydraulic fluid from moving. This is a big problem because you cannot just turn on the machine. You have to wait for everything to thaw, or replace damaged parts. This causes unexpected delays and makes your production schedule unreliable. You lose money with every minute the machine is down.<\/li>\n<\/ul>\n<h2>How Does a Low-Temperature Hydraulic System Ensure Unwavering Performance?<\/h2>\n<p>Are you tired of machine breakdowns when the cold weather arrives? It tackles the cold head-on, so you do not have to worry about unexpected stoppages.<\/p>\n<h3>Key Features of a Reliable Low-Temperature Hydraulic System<\/h3>\n<ul>\n<li><strong>Specialized Hydraulic Fluids:<\/strong> The most important change is the type of hydraulic oil used. A low-temperature hydraulic system uses fluids with a very low pour point and stable viscosity across a wide temperature range. This means the oil stays thin and flows easily, even when the temperature is far below zero. It does not get thick and sluggish like standard oil. This ensures quick startup and smooth operation from the moment the machine turns on. It also protects the pump and other components from unnecessary strain. This specialized fluid is formulated to resist thickening, preventing the most common cause of cold-weather failures.<\/li>\n<li><strong>Integrated Heating Systems:<\/strong> Many low-temperature hydraulic units come with built-in heating elements. These heaters warm the hydraulic oil before the machine starts. They also maintain an optimal temperature during operation. This pre-heating makes sure the oil is at the right viscosity right away. It also stops condensation from forming inside the system. Think of it as a warm-up for the machine before it begins its work. Some systems use immersion heaters in the oil tank. Others use line heaters along the hydraulic lines. These heaters are often controlled by thermostats, turning on automatically when the temperature drops. This removes the worry of manual heating or long warm-up times.<\/li>\n<li><strong>Cold-Resistant Materials and Seals:<\/strong> Every part of a low-temperature hydraulic system is chosen for its ability to withstand extreme cold. This includes the hoses, seals, O-rings, and metal components. They are made from special materials that do not become brittle or lose their flexibility at low temperatures. For example, specific rubber compounds or synthetic polymers are used for seals. These materials maintain their sealing integrity. They prevent leaks and cracks that are common in standard systems exposed to cold. This ensures the entire system remains leak-free and strong, even under constant stress in freezing conditions. This careful material selection drastically reduces the risk of component failure.<\/li>\n<\/ul>\n<h2>What Operational Gains Can a Reliable Coil Upender Deliver for Your Factory?<\/h2>\n<p>Are your current packing processes slow, costly, and unsafe?
